How It Works
Mechanism of Action
Urolithin A activates mitophagy by inducing the PINK1/Parkin pathway, promoting the selective removal of damaged mitochondria. It upregulates PGC-1α expression, enhancing mitochondrial biogenesis and increasing cellular ATP production. The compound also modulates NF-κB signaling to reduce inflammatory cytokine production.
Clinical Evidence
Human clinical trials with 500-1000mg daily doses show Urolithin A increases cellular ATP by up to 30% and improves muscle endurance markers. A 4-month randomized controlled trial in 60 elderly adults demonstrated significant improvements in mitochondrial gene expression and muscle function. However, most evidence comes from small-scale studies, and larger long-term trials are needed to confirm safety and efficacy across diverse populations.
Safety & Interactions
Urolithin A appears well-tolerated in clinical studies with minimal reported side effects at doses up to 1000mg daily. Some individuals may experience mild gastrointestinal upset during initial supplementation. No significant drug interactions have been reported, but individuals taking medications for diabetes should monitor blood glucose levels. Safety during pregnancy and breastfeeding has not been established.

What foods naturally contain urolithin A?
Urolithin A is produced when gut bacteria metabolize ellagitannins found in pomegranates, walnuts, raspberries, and strawberries. However, not everyone can produce urolithin A naturally due to individual gut microbiome differences.

Is urolithin A better than PQQ for mitochondrial health?
Urolithin A and PQQ work through different mechanisms - Urolithin A promotes mitophagy while PQQ supports mitochondrial biogenesis. Urolithin A has stronger clinical evidence for muscle health, while PQQ shows benefits for cognitive function and neuroprotection.
